I used the Pampered Pets Stamp Set plus the Playful Pets Designer Series Paper such beautiful designs and so easy to work with. It also has Dies that work with both the stamps and the DSP brilliant.

These are a type of Easel card which when you pull the ribbon the card pops up revealing the images inside how cool is that and then you write your message on the back of the card.


I think this style of card is so versatile and you can use many many images on them and I am sure I will be doing so as once you get the hang of gluing the insides correctly you are off and running.

Stampin Up! Grove Dies Diorama Card featuring New Horizons DSP

 I have to say that the  Stampin Up! "Grove Die" set which goes alongside the "Grassy Grove"cling stamp set was over looked by me in the first look through the January-June Mini Catalogue but I'm so glad I popped back in and placed another order which included this bundle after seeing other demo's featuring this amazing set.

I took inspiration from the catalogue and made my first card with several of the dies from the set.


I used the large stand alone Die from the bundle which gives this wonderful forest look effect. I also used a couple of the deers the tall mum looking back at her youngster probably saying stop dawdling lets get a move on.

This card is in the style of a double diorama and I learnt this from a fellow demo's Youtube video I must look up her name and add it here for you well worth a watch.



   You can see from the above image looking down through the centre that the front and back pieces of the card are joined at the sides which gives the impression of a picture frame. I love this and can see many more cards in this style coming int he future watch this space as they say.

I also used the New Horizon DSP just stunning images which allows you to make a very effective card in a very short space of time. I'm hoping all these items carry over from the mini into the next annual catalogue.

This is another card I made up at the same time with a different sheet from the DSP which is 6x6 but this time I didn't use the deer. It just draws the eyes off into the distance giving such a calming effect I thought.
